    When you choose to use Assistant Furret, it is your responsibility to fill your team with all sorts of ridiculous attacks, namely strong, potentially deadly, and/or ridiculous moves such as Spore, Belly Drum, and AncientPower, as well as moves for Pokémon who have high defenses and manage to resist both Normal and Ghost moves. Remember that Assist pulls moves from even Pokémon who have already fainted. This moveset is not for the faint of heart; if you don't like tempting Lady Fate, steer clear of the Assistant.

    Unlike the Trickster, whose main goal is to get Choice Band onto an opposing Pokémon, this one simply wants to use the item in all its glory. Unlike most other Choice Banders where the main goal is to have a diversified set of attacks to cover possible counter-switches, Choice Band Furret's moves are for limiting the options available to the opponent in addition to using the added attack power from Choice Band to boost Furret's offense. Focus Punch and Pursuit are good for predicting switches, while U-turn completely takes the mystery out of that dilemma. Sucker Punch is a solid move for hitting opponents who think they can beat you through with their higher Speed.

    Furret has the benefit of being a fairly speedy little critter, and so it can get the jump on a fair number of opponents and force a Choice item onto them. The other moves are there to play mind games with the opponent once you've tricked the item on. Sucker Punch + Focus Punch places your opponent in a "damned if you do, damned if you don't" situation, though keep in mind that Furret still isn't that strong on offense. You can replace one of the last two moveslots with Protect to scout for any strong attacks that may result from placing a Choice item on something that can actually take advantage of it. Choice Scarf allows you to outspeed more Pokémon, while Choice Band allows Furret to actually do good damage if you decide to hold off on using Trick.

    The EVs listed are for the Choice Scarf version. If you're using Choice Band instead, use a 168 Atk / 88 Def / 252 Spe Jolly spread.




    Altre Opzioni


    Furret has a very impressive movepool worthy of its Normal typing, though perhaps not the stats to use them. On the physical side it learns ThunderPunch, Ice Punch and Fire Punch, which can all find their place on the Choice Band set. Furret's Special Attack is terrible, but the number of options available (Surf, Thunderbolt, Thunder, Fire Blast, Grass Knot, among others) are still an option for taking down high-Defense, low-Special Defense Pokémon who are especially weak to those attacks, e.g. Skarmory, Golem. Furret also learns Baton Pass. Though it doesn't have many moves worth passing beyond Substitute or Amnesia, it's also another option for manipulating switches, and unlike U-turn Baton Pass doesn't have to worry about not working due to missing. Furret's decent Speed means Me First is not a completely terrible option. Note that a number of Furret's good attacks (Pursuit, Covet, Charm, Reversal, Assist) are all egg moves, and that the key to getting them all at once is Smeargle. On the Trickster set, you can try to use Choice Specs in case you think giving additional Speed to your opponent via Choice Scarf is still too powerful a bonus for physical attackers.

    EV


    Furret generally wants to pump significant EVs into Attack and Speed, its two best stats. However, if you're Tricking items onto your opponent, you may want to give some defensive EVs to Furret so it has a chance of surviving a boosted attack. Very few attacks won't leave Furret for dead, but a little bit of Defense might just come in handy.

    Considerazioni


    Furret is not especially powerful, but the sheer number of options available to it makes Furret quite an unpredictable Pokémon. While it is lacking power to take on some of the big boys of Pokémon, against lesser opponents Furret's mind games can leave them flustered. In most cases, regardless of the opponents Furret is facing, the goal is to limit the opponent's options and give opportunities for heavier hitters to come in and do their jobs. Furret might go down pretty quickly, but it'll do so in a blaze of comedic glory.

    Counter


    In any tier, the main threat to Furret will be Pokémon who already have or do not mind Choice items, notably Fighting-types due to being able to score super effective damage while resisting bug and dark attacks and being able to throw out the occasional Mach Punch. Heracross in Standard is especially threatening, due to it frequently having Choice Band or Choice Scarf anyway, while in other tiers Hitmonlee, Hitmonchan, and Hitmontop will give Furret grief. The threat is less from specific Pokémon, and more from basically neutralizing the whole purpose of Furret.
